LER Product Design, LLC in Columbus, Indiana seeks an ADAS/ADS Evaluation Engineer to assess current and future driver-assistance and automated driving systems across Columbus and other U.S. worksites.
The role includes hands-on vehicle testing, data gathering, and collaboration with suppliers. You will configure test vehicles, sensors, and data acquisition gear, analyze results, and support the tuning of ADAS features such as AEB, CIB, and ACC for North American roads.

LER Product Design, LLC seeks an ADAS/ADS Evaluation Engineer in Columbus, Indiana, and various unanticipated worksites throughout the U.S. Telecommuting permitted 1 day/week. Duties: evaluate current and future Advanced Driver Assistance Systems (ADAS)/Automated Driving Systems (ADS) to ensure compliance with defined performance requirements; prepare systems, vehicles, test equipment, and logistics for evaluation drives, and analyze collected data; support the evaluation and tuning of ADAS and ADS, focusing on North American road conditions; support the development and initial implementation of proof-of-concept systems; configure, modify, and troubleshoot test vehicles, sensors, and data acquisition equipment; communicate performance issues to suppliers and support proposals for appropriate countermeasures; implement quantitative benchmark methods for ADAS for competitor vehicles using GPS, cameras and other sensors; complete data gathering evaluations on public roads and proving grounds; analyze test data and recommend performance changes.
Bachelor's degree in mechanical engineering, automotive systems engineering, or related field, and two years of experience in a vehicle validation engineering position. Must have two years of experience in all of the following: CANalyzer, Vbox, or Panel 4; ADAS software validation; HIL-based testing and validation of digital control systems; vehicle testing of safety feature performance, including Autonomous Emergency Braking (AEB), Crash Imminent Braking (CIB), and Adaptive Cruise Control (ACC).
